I have the front end off the ground, and am unsure where to put the jackstands?? The only place seems to be under the torsion bar mounts, or the sway bar main bushings?? I am planing to have a four wheel jackstand thing happening until at least noon tomorrow, and I have to jack both ends one after the other. I don't want them so far forward that iit puts a strain on the frame? Help me out if you will, sitting on the jack right now. ,,,,BB
#2
Place them under the side rails behind the front tires. Its the stronger section of the body...kinda lookd like a frame rails for a truck but not nearly as large. I used to put them under the subframe near where the lower control arms are but they'd sometimes get in the way. The side rails are the best location since they give alot of space.
